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Kargo Expression Language Reference for secret can use global secret #3205

Open
3 tasks done
akolacz opened this issue Jan 3, 2025 · 1 comment
Open
3 tasks done

Comments

@akolacz
Copy link
Contributor

akolacz commented Jan 3, 2025

Checklist

  • I've searched the issue queue to verify this is not a duplicate feature request.
  • I've pasted the output of kargo version, if applicable.
  • I've pasted logs, if applicable.

Proposed Feature

I would like to have the possibility like global credentials for registry, github etc... to use/reference an global secret with Kargo Expression Language Reference instead of have the same secret in each kargo project.

Motivation

We used in our cases the http promotion to send notifications through slack and we need to setup the bearer token for X kargo project we have, it's for this we would have this secret global and can be used by the Expression Language Reference.

@krancour
Copy link
Member

krancour commented Jan 3, 2025

Absolutely can/will do this. Will need to put some thought into the UX. With secrets that come only from within the Project, there's no possibility of name collision, but this would introduce a need for qualifying secrets by namespace when referencing them from within an expression.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

2 participants